2013-08-28 3 views
0

Nous essayons d'accéder à notre application Web (via le serveur Web, IHS). Lorsque nous utilisons http, nous allons bien; Le protocole https fonctionne en même temps qu'il soumet les requêtes, mais nous observons une exception Socket Time Out en continu après que certaines demandes ont été traitées. Ensuite, le traitement de la requête reprend à nouveau. Nous avons testé l'application avec une charge simultanée relativement importante en utilisant https plus tôt; mais dans ce cas, nous ne savons pas pourquoi nous recevons cette erreur.Socket a expiré

+0

javax.xml.soap.SOAPException: java.net.SocketTimeoutException: l'opération de socket a expiré avant qu'elle puisse être terminée à org.apache.axis.message.SOAPFaultBuilder.createFault (SOAPFaultBuilder .java: 225) à org.apache. axis.message.SOAPFaultBuilder.endElement (SOAPFaultBuilder .java: 128) – user2029261

Répondre

0

Oh mon garçon, cela peut être dû à des milliers de choses différentes. Je suggérerais une approche d'analyse de couche commençant par les journaux de Web Server, vous devez vous assurer que les demandes atteignent votre serveur Web et ce qui arrive à ceux qui dictent un délai, vous pourriez être confronté à n'importe quoi de la latence du réseau à une ressource hôte borné, contention ou qui sait, tout dépend de la conception de votre application.

Commencez par vérifier la couche réseau. Peut-être que si vous fournissez plus d'informations, je peux vous aider.

Vérifiez également les configurations de temporisation http et https sur votre serveur Web.